334 void nstat_route_new_entry(struct rtentry *rt);
335 void nstat_pcb_detach(struct inpcb *inp);
336
337 // locked_add_64 uses atomic operations on 32bit so the 64bit
338 // value can be properly read. The values are only ever incremented
339 // while under the socket lock, so on 64bit we don't actually need
340 // atomic operations to increment.
341 #if defined(__LP64__)
342 #define locked_add_64(__addr, __count) do { \
343 *(__addr) += (__count); \
344 } while (0)
345 #else
346 #define locked_add_64(__addr, __count) do { \
347 atomic_add_64((__addr), (__count)); \
348 } while (0)
349 #endif
